Season 10, Episode 9

Jamie struggles to protect his family from gang threats, but finds his enemies are very well informed. Avril ignores Jackson's warnings and continues to work as a rogue pharmacist, and Lillian faces her toughest challenge yet as she takes her British citizenship test. Meanwhile, Frank and Dom compete to claim the greatest number of conquests on the Chatsworth estate

David Threlfall (Actor) .. Frank Gallagher
Born: October 12, 1953 in Manchester
Best Known For: Playing foul-mouthed Frank Gallagher in Shameless.
Early-life: Born in Manchester on October 12, 1953. He has a brother; their father was a plumber. David never wanted to be an actor, his first love was football, but thanks to a little encouragement from teachers, he trod the boards in a school production of The Crucible. After a short stint at art college in Sheffield, and a few months labouring, he became a student at Manchester Polytechnic School of Drama. His breakthrough role came in the gritty 1977 drama Scum.
Career: Aside from a lean period at the back end of the 1990s, Threlfall has rarely been out of work. His small-screen work includes roles in Mike Leigh's Kiss of Death, a 1984 staging of King Lear (opposite Laurence Olivier), Conspiracy and The Queen's Sister. His most famous on-screen character is that of chain-smoking patriarch Frank Gallagher, a role he held in Channel 4 drama Shameless between 2004 and 2013. Other projects include The Russia House, Master and Commander: The Far Side of the World, Housewife 49, Hot Fuzz, Nowhere Boy and The Ark. He was also made a surprisingly good Tommy Cooper in the ITV biopic Not Like That, Like This.
Quote: On acting: "I just like getting up and pretending. It's the game of pretending you're other people, that's the liberating thing."
Trivia: He supports Manchester City. He received an honorary doctorate from Manchester Metropolitan University in 2013.

Tina Malone (Actor) .. Mimi Tutton
Born: January 30, 1963 in Liverpool
Best Known For: Shameless.
Early-life: Tina Malone was born in Liverpool on January 30, 1963. She attended Liverpool Institute High School for Girls and showed a passion for acting. After some minor TV roles, she landed parts in Brookside and Blonde Fist, as well as appearing in Victoria Wood's dinnerladies, before landing a part as the terrifying Mimi Maguire in Shameless in 2005.
Career: Malone has been praised for her acting but her own personality came to the fore when she was a contestant on Celebrity Big Brother in 2009, where she was one of the more popular housemates. Since then, she has also received recognition for her extraordinary weight loss - having a gastric balloon fitted to help her lose four stone in weight. She has been outspoken about her bipolar disorder and health problems. She also runs a theatre school in Liverpool.
Quote: "You can go on forever about ‘my metabolism slower than yours.' The point is: you need to exercise to speed up your metabolism and then you can eat anything you want in life. But just have a bite, not the whole box which is what I've done for 15 years."
Trivia: In December 2013, at the age of 50, she gave birth to a daughter.
